#1e0e72 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1e0e72 is composed of 11.8% red, 5.5%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.7% cyan, 87.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 249.6 degrees, a saturation of 78.1% and a lightness of 25.1%. #1e0e72 color hex could be obtained by blending #3c1ce4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

Shades and Tints of #1e0e72
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020109 is the darkest color, while #f8f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1e0e72
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3f3f41 is the less saturated color, while #17047c is the most saturated one.
